Blood Pressure
The force exerted by circulating blood on the walls of blood vessels, typically measured in the upper arm.
Potassium Ion
A positively charged ion (K+) that is vital for various physiological processes including nerve transmission, muscle contraction, and heart function.
Heart Rate
The number of heartbeats per unit of time, usually measured in beats per minute (bpm), indicative of cardiovascular health and physical condition.
Parasympathetic Nerve
A part of the autonomic nervous system that conserves energy as it slows the heart rate, increases intestinal and gland activity.
